diff options
Diffstat (limited to 'parts/overlays')
| -rw-r--r-- | parts/overlays/btop.nix | 14 | ||||
| -rw-r--r-- | parts/overlays/default.nix | 7 | ||||
| -rw-r--r-- | parts/overlays/discord.nix | 31 | ||||
| -rw-r--r-- | parts/overlays/fish.nix | 14 |
4 files changed, 0 insertions, 66 deletions
diff --git a/parts/overlays/btop.nix b/parts/overlays/btop.nix deleted file mode 100644 index b2a5b24..0000000 --- a/parts/overlays/btop.nix +++ /dev/null @@ -1,14 +0,0 @@ -_: prev: { - btop = - if prev.stdenv.isLinux - then - prev.symlinkJoin { - inherit (prev.btop) passthru; - name = "btop-nodesktop"; - paths = [prev.btop]; - postBuild = '' - rm $out/share/applications/btop.desktop - ''; - } - else prev.btop; -} diff --git a/parts/overlays/default.nix b/parts/overlays/default.nix deleted file mode 100644 index 66869c4..0000000 --- a/parts/overlays/default.nix +++ /dev/null @@ -1,7 +0,0 @@ -{lib, ...}: { - flake.overlays.default = lib.composeManyExtensions [ - (import ./btop.nix) - (import ./discord.nix) - (import ./fish.nix) - ]; -} diff --git a/parts/overlays/discord.nix b/parts/overlays/discord.nix deleted file mode 100644 index dfb0cae..0000000 --- a/parts/overlays/discord.nix +++ /dev/null @@ -1,31 +0,0 @@ -_: prev: let - mkOverride = d: let - # TODO: re-enable openASAR when gnome wayland decorations work with it - d' = d; #.override {withOpenASAR = true;}; - inherit (d') pname; - - desktopName = - if pname == "discord-canary" - then "Discord Canary" - else "Discord"; - - flags = "--enable-gpu-rasterization --enable-zero-copy --enable-gpu-compositing --enable-native-gpu-memory-buffers --enable-oop-rasterization --enable-features=UseSkiaRenderer,WaylandWindowDecorations"; - desktopItem = prev.makeDesktopItem { - name = pname; - exec = "${builtins.replaceStrings [" "] [""] desktopName} ${flags}"; - icon = pname; - inherit desktopName; - genericName = d'.meta.description; - categories = ["Network" "InstantMessaging"]; - mimeTypes = ["x-scheme-handler/discord"]; - }; - in - if prev.stdenv.isLinux - then d'.overrideAttrs (_: {inherit desktopItem;}) - else if (pname == "discord" && prev.stdenv.isDarwin) - then d' - else d; -in { - discord = mkOverride prev.discord; - discord-canary = mkOverride prev.discord-canary; -} diff --git a/parts/overlays/fish.nix b/parts/overlays/fish.nix deleted file mode 100644 index 4e7fffc..0000000 --- a/parts/overlays/fish.nix +++ /dev/null @@ -1,14 +0,0 @@ -_: prev: { - fish = - if prev.stdenv.isLinux - then - prev.symlinkJoin { - inherit (prev.fish) passthru; - name = "fish-nodesktop"; - paths = [prev.fish]; - postBuild = '' - rm $out/share/applications/fish.desktop - ''; - } - else prev.fish; -} |
